What's The Definition Of Controversialist?

[n] a person who disputes; who is good at or enjoys controversy

Synonyms | Synonyms for Controversialist: disputant

Controversialist In Webster's Dictionary

\Con`tro*ver"sial*ist\, n. One who carries on a controversy; a disputant. He [Johnson] was both intellectually and morally of the stuff of which controversialists are made. --Macaulay.
